Ingredients


– 1 package of vegan puff pastry (thawed)
– 2 large potatoes (peeled and diced)
– 1 cup frozen peas
– 1 medium onion (finely chopped)
– 2 cloves garlic (minced)
– 1 tablespoon ginger (grated)
– 1 teaspoon cumin seeds
– 1 teaspoon coriander powder
– 1 teaspoon garam masala
– ½ teaspoon turmeric powder
– ½ teaspoon chili powder (adjust to taste)
– Salt to taste
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– Fresh cilantro (for garnish)
– Non-dairy milk (for brushing)

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ating the Easy Vegan Samosa Pie is a breeze if you follow these simple steps:
1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
2. Boil the Potatoes: In a pot, boil the diced potatoes until tender, about 10-15 minutes. Drain and set aside.
3. Sauté the Onion: In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 5 minutes.
4. Add Garlic and Ginger: Stir in the minced garlic and grated ginger, cooking for another minute until fragrant.
5. Spice it Up: Add cumin seeds, coriander powder, garam masala, turmeric, chili powder, and salt. Stir for 1-2 minutes until the spices are well combined.
6. Combine Filling: Add the boiled potatoes and frozen peas to the skillet. Mix everything well and cook for another 5 minutes. Remove from heat and let cool slightly.
7. Prepare Puff Pastry: Roll out the thawed puff pastry on a lightly floured surface. Cut it into two large circles, one for the base and one for the top.
8. Assemble the Pie: Place one circle of pastry in a pie dish. Fill it with the potato-pea mixture. Cover with the second pastry circle and seal the edges by pressing them together. Cut a few slits on top for steam to escape.
9. Brush with Non-Dairy Milk: Brush the top of the pie with non-dairy milk for a golden finish.
10. Bake: Place in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es or until golden brown and crispy.
11. Cool and Garnish: Remove from the oven and allow to cool for a few minutes.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ving.

Additional Tips


Use Fresh Spices: For the best flavor, use fresh spices. Ground spices lose potency over time, so investing in whole spices can elevate your dish.
Experiment with Flavors: Feel free to adjust the spices according to your preferences. Add a pinch of cinnamon or nutmeg for a unique twist.
Serve Hot: This Easy Vegan Samosa Pie is best enjoyed warm. Reheat if needed, to bring back its crispy texture.
Garnish Creatively: Consider adding a drizzle of coconut yogurt or a sprinkle of chili flakes for an extra kick of flavor.


Recipe Variation


You can easily customize the Easy Vegan Samosa Pie with these variations:
1. Sweet Potato Filling: Substitute the potatoes with sweet potatoes for a sweeter flavor and a vibrant color.
2. Add Lentils: Incorporate cooked lentils for added protein and texture, making the filling heartier.
3. Spicy Version: Increase the chili powder or add chopped green chilies to ramp up the heat for spice lovers.
4. Mixed Vegetables: Instead of just peas, add diced carrots or bell peppers to give more variety to the filling.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: Keep leftover Easy Vegan Samosa Pie in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It should last about 3-4 days.
Freezing: You can freeze the assembled, unbaked pie or leftover slices. Wrap them tightly in plastic wrap and foil. It will keep well for up to 3 months. Thaw in the refrigerator before baking or reheating.

Frequently Asked Questions


Can I use store-bought filling?
Yes, you can use pre-made vegetable or lentil filling to save time.
How can I make the pastry gluten-free?
Look for gluten-free puff pastry options available at specialty stores or supermarkets.
Can I air fry this pie?
Absolutely! An air fryer can achieve a crispy texture. Just adjust the cooking time to about 20-25 minutes at 375°F (190°C).
What can I serve with this pie?
Pair with a simple cucumber salad or a side of roasted vegetables for a complete meal.
